Rendezvous webcast: Encouraging Plain Language

Posted by on February 13th, 2013 0 comments

Edit: A recording is now available at https://webmeeting.nih.gov/p43131671/ Given the nation’s limited health literacy, it is essential that clear communication and plain language become standard across medical and public health settings. The Program for Readability In Science & Medicine (PRISM) is a successful plain language initiative launched at Group Health Research Institute (GHRI) in 2005…. Read More »

Disaster Summit: Magnitude 9 Cascadia Earthquake

Posted by on February 1st, 2013 0 comments

Event Date: Tuesday, March 26, 2013 What would you do in the event of a major earthquake in the Pacific Northwest? With whom would you need to coordinate to continue to provide needed services?  NN/LM PNR is pleased to announce a one-day disaster summit to address these types of questions.
